Description
The property welcomes you through a side extension, creating a practical hallway that sets the tone for the home. At the end of the hall, you'll find a smart downstairs shower room, a rare and convenient addition, as well as access to a useful utility room tucked just off the kitchen.
To the rear, a further extension brings in natural light via wide bi-fold doors, opening directly onto the west-facing garden. This flexible space has been constructed but awaits finishing touches, allowing new owners to style and configure it to their own taste. It could remain a cosy separate living area or be opened through to the kitchen, forming a large, flowing open-plan hub for cooking, dining, and entertaining.
Upstairs, the three bedrooms provide ample family accommodation, alongside the house bathroom.
Externally, the garden wraps around the home. To the rear the garden faces west offering a wonderful private retreat, perfect for summer evenings, gardening, or simply relaxing with friends and family.
With its characterful 1920s build, extended layout, and the opportunity to personalise, this cottage is perfectly placed to enjoy Roundhay's excellent schools, vibrant community, and the famous Roundhay Park just moments away.
